Abstract
Shea butter contains vitamin E and high in fatty acids, which help in treating dry skin and eczema due to the presence of natural ingredients from shea nut. The usage of shea butter has been widely used in few countries especially in Africa. The main objective of this work was to prepare and characterize the shea butter cream with different amount of olive and coconut oil. The cream samples were prepared using double-boil method before checking the characteristics of the cream. The basic criteria that had been considered was pH, colour and spreadability. Further analysis on FTIR to determine the peak component of the sample cream while UVVIS to detect the presence of phenol and saturated fatty acids. Antimicrobial activity of cream on solid media was examined by applying streaking method. All creams prepared were within required pH value 6-8; yellowish colour obtained and easily absorbed by the skin which representing natural condition for human skin. Based on the results obtained, the FTIR peak of each cream samples include the commercialized cream showed the presence stretch of cis=C-H and cis-C=C- stretch that indicate the presence of unsaturated fatty acids at 2000-3000 cm-1 wavelength. Moreover, all petri plates containing E.coli inhibit the growth of E.coli on the nutrient agar.
